What is the stated purpose and benefit of listening to Sai Baba's stories as described in the Shri Sai Satcharitra?

📖 Chapter 36

Chapter 36 of the Shri Sai Satcharitra explains that listening to Sai's stories offers profound spiritual benefits. The text describes them not as mere tales, but as 'the very water of self-bliss' which, when consumed, increases the devotee's thirst for more. It is stated that respectfully listening to these narrations removes the fatigue and misery of worldly existence, leading to a state of happiness. The chapter suggests that this practice is a way for a fortunate soul to achieve their own spiritual welfare and that the stories purify the ears of the listeners and the mouths of the speakers.
